Former BetBright Chairman partners with BetVictor to settle ante-post bets
By Matthew Enderby

Ricci, BetBright’s former Executive Chairman, is acting in a personal capacity to settle bets voided when the company ceased operations on 5 March.

Customers can now choose to have their bets reinstated with BetVictor by 4 April; to do so they are required to have a valid account with the operator.

All wagers will be honoured, whatever the result, with the exception of those from the Cheltenham Festival.

Commenting on the partnership, Rich Ricci said: "I am pleased that, with the help of BetVictor, ante-post bets placed by BetBright customers can be honoured."

Director of Sportsbook at BetVictor, Matt Scarrott, said: "We’re happy to be supporting Rich to address this situation, enabling former BetBright punters to reinstate their ante-post bets via our BetVictor betting platform."

BetBright ceased operations following its £15m ($19.6m) acquisition by 888 Holdings on 4 March.

Players were allowed access to their accounts for 30 days following the deal, with BetBright advising customers to withdraw the full balance from their accounts.

Wagers due to be settled post 5 March were voided, while multiple bets that have winning legs were settled as a winning bet, with the rest of the unsettled legs voided.
